First sergeant vs drill sergeant

The differences between first sergeants and drill sergeants can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a drill sergeant has an average salary of $100,889, which is higher than the $98,755 average annual salary of a first sergeant.

The top three skills for a first sergeant include personnel actions, professional development and general supervision. The most important skills for a drill sergeant are safety procedures, physical fitness training, and individual training.
